With Ramadan scheduled to begin this Wednesday, Dubai life is already starting to slow down in preparation for the Holy Month. During Ramadan Muslims fast from sunrise to sunset. It is a time when importance is given to separating the physical from the spiritual. One gives back to the community, to charity, and spends more time with family and friends over wonderful meals as soon as the fast is broken. For such a cosmopolitan city like Dubai, this might create hindrance for those used to the party scene, the sophisticated bars and nightclubs many of which slow down almost to a complete halt during the Holy Month. But what you can look forward to are the wonder iftar meals full of delicious treats in a variety of settings where you can literally feast until your heart's content.
